WebAs you can see above, the size of a 1 carat diamond is approximately 6.5mm ( based on the assumption that the stone is cut to ideal proportions ). On the other hand, the size of a .5 carat diamond is approximately 5.2mm. Even though the carat weight is 50% of a 1 carat stone, it doesn’t face up twice as small!

Longer chains (28+ inches) can slip … how to calculate recapture rateWebWhen looking at sizing, there are two ways to measure. The first method is to take a tape measure and drape it around the neck to the point where you would like the necklace to fall. The second method is to use a piece of yarn and wrap that in the same fashion and then mark it with a marker to indicate how long the necklace should be. mgn chemical nameWebMar 21, 2024 · Necklace Length.
